EDITORS COMMENTS
This postcard image, dated 1898, showcases the enchanting scene of Edirne, Turkey's banks of the Maritsa River. The serene waterway, meandering through the landscape, is bordered by lush greenery and picturesque buildings that reflect its tranquil surface. At the heart of the scene, the iconic Gazi Mihal Bridge spans the river, connecting the Old Town and the New Town. Its elegant arches and intricate stonework are a testament to the rich history of the Ottoman Empire. In the foreground, the bustling Flea Market comes alive with activity. Vendors display an array of colorful goods, enticing passersby with their wares. The market, a vibrant and integral part of Edirne's cultural heritage, is a feast for the senses, with the aroma of freshly cooked food, the sound of lively negotiations, and the sight of intricately patterned textiles and ceramics. This postcard, published by Max Fruchtermann, offers a glimpse into the past, transporting us back in time to the late 19th century. It is a beautiful reminder of the historical significance and enduring charm of Edirne, a city that continues to captivate visitors with its rich history, stunning architecture, and vibrant markets.
